What beer is a pilsner?

pale lager beer
A pilsner (sometimes referred to as “pilsener” in some locales, or “pils” as slang) is a type of pale lager beer that originated in the Czech Republic city of Plzeň (anglicized as the city of Pilsen). Bavarian brewer Josef Groll is widely believed to have developed the first pilsner beer in the nineteenth century.

Why are pilsners so popular?

Pilsner happens to be the most recognizable and has the signature look and taste of what many beer drinkers expect from a lager. As with many good things, simplicity is the key to pilsner’s success. Pilsner is brewed with pilsner malt and lager yeast, which is bottom-fermenting and distinguishes lagers from ales.

What is the original Pilsner beer?

History. Pilsner Urquell was the first pale lager, and the name pilsner is often used by its copies. It is characterised by its golden colour and clarity, and was immensely successful: nine out of ten beers produced and consumed in the world are pale lagers based on Pilsner Urquell.

Is Stella Artois a pilsner?

Stella is officially classified as a Euro Pale Lager, but some consider it to be a pilsner. It pours like most lagers—with a thin, white head and a crisp, golden color. It is traditionally served in a signature Stella Artois chalice; however, a normal beer pint will do just fine, as long as it is poured correctly.
